Sixth form global impact programme

Year 12 or 13, aged 16 to 18, paired with a doctorate mentor and small team across five impact categories, October to June, one to three hours weekly, mid-year review in London, international deployment in July.

Research mentor programme

Current university students, at any UK university, lead a team of six sixth formers in your field, one to three hours weekly, travel internationally for deployment, top six groups travel all six continents.

Community impact grant

Anyone aged 16 and over based in England, identified a real local need, ready to build something, rolling applications reviewed within four weeks.

Questions

Everything you need to know before you apply.

Do I need supervisor approval?

Yes. Your doctorate supervisor must approve your participation. We'll send you a form to submit with your application. This isn't bureaucracy—it's respect for the work you're already doing.

Can first-year sixth formers apply?

No. You must be in Year 12 or Year 13. First-year students can apply the following year. We want people who've had time to understand what commitment means.

Is travel funding provided?

Yes. All international travel is funded. Accommodation, flights, meals—we cover it. You bring the work. We handle the logistics.

What if my group isn't in the top six?

You still run your programme. You still deploy. You just deploy within the UK instead of internationally. The impact is real either way.

How are groups judged?

We look at clarity of need, feasibility of solution, team composition, and mentor experience. We're not looking for perfect plans. We're looking for people who understand the problem and have the grit to solve it.
